Typical Types of Damage
Surface Area Scratches and Scuffs
These small surface area damages can occur from everyday usage, like dragging furnishings or just basic wear.
Damages and Dings
Accidental effects can develop damages, especially if a heavy product strikes the door.
Discoloration and Fading
Exposure to UV rays can trigger fading over time, reducing the door's aesthetic appeal.
Lock and Hinge Issues
Misalignment in locks or hinges can render a door unusable if not dealt with immediately.
Weather-Related Damage
Wetness can cause warping, while severe temperature levels can impact the structural stability of the door.
Repair Techniques for UPVC Doors
Fixing UPVC doors can range from basic DIY methods to professional interventions, depending upon the intensity of the damage. Here's a classified breakdown of typical repairs:
1. Surface Scratches and ScuffsMaterials Needed: UPVC cleaner, microfiber fabric, fine-grade sandpaper (if necessary), and UPVC polish.Repair Steps:StepAction1Tidy the affected area with UPVC cleaner using a microfiber fabric.2Examine the depth of the scratch. If it is deep, gently sand the area with fine-grade sandpaper.3Wipe tidy and apply UPVC polish for a smooth finish.2. Dents and DingsMaterials Needed: Hairdryer, cloth, ice bag (or ice bag), and a smidgen of water.Repair Steps:StepAction1Heat the dinged up location with a hairdryer for 30-60 seconds, keeping it about 6 inches away.2Immediately cover the heated location with a wet fabric.3Put an ice bag over the fabric to cool it rapidly, which can assist improve the damage.3. Staining and FadingMaterials Needed: UPVC cleaner, polishing compound, and paint (if needed).Repair Steps:StepAction1Clean the door thoroughly using the UPVC cleaner.2If fading is severe, consider painting the door with a UPVC Door Technician-compatible paint.3Apply polishing substance to restore shine to the surface area.4. Lock and Hinge IssuesMaterials Needed: Lubricant, screwdriver, and a wrench (if needed).Repair Steps:StepAction1Inspect locks and hinges for rust or misalignment.2Oil the locks and hinges with a silicone spray or graphite.3Tighten loose screws or replace them as essential.5. Weather-Related DamageProducts Needed: Caulk, weather condition stripping, and a putty knife.Repair Steps:StepAction1Examine for gaps and seals that might be broken.2Apply new caulk where necessary to seal gaps.3Set up brand-new weather removing around the door edges if required.Preventative Maintenance Tips for UPVC Doors
